Added PostgresqlReplicationLagHigh rule (#456)

* Added PostgresqlReplicationLagHigh rule

* Update PostgreSQL replication lag alert settings

---------

Co-authored-by: Samuel Berthe <dev@samuel-berthe.fr>
This commit is contained in:
Motte 2025-03-27 14:42:22 +01:00 committed by GitHub
parent 97a31f34e5
commit 69c8208e3c
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
2 changed files with 14 additions and 0 deletions

View file

@ -747,6 +747,11 @@ groups:
for: 6h
comments: |
See https://github.com/samber/awesome-prometheus-alerts/issues/289#issuecomment-1164842737
- name: Postgresql replication lag high
description: The PostgreSQL replication lag is high (> 60s)
query: "pg_replication_lag_seconds > 5"
severity: warning
for: 30s
- name: SQL Server
exporters:

View file

@ -192,3 +192,12 @@ groups:
annotations:
summary: Postgresql invalid index (instance {{ $labels.instance }})
description: "The table {{ $labels.relname }} has an invalid index: {{ $labels.indexrelname }}. You should execute `DROP INDEX {{ $labels.indexrelname }};`\n VALUE = {{ $value }}\n LABELS = {{ $labels }}"
- alert: PostgresqlReplicationLagHigh
expr: 'pg_replication_lag_seconds > 60'
for: 2m
labels:
severity: warning
annotations:
summary: Postgresql replication lag high (> 60s) (instance {{ $labels.instance }})
description: "The PostgreSQL replication lag is high\n VALUE = {{ $value }}\n LABELS = {{ $labels }}"